The Process

How this coffee was produced

It is a washed process with a 36 hour fermentation in open tanks.

Harvesting and Stabilization

Coffee is hand-picked and sorted, where 95%. they are depulped immediately and kept in open tanks adding new batches.

Processing and Fermentation

She gathers small batches for 3 to 5 days and ferments them for 36 hours in open tanks.

Drying

Dried in sun bed driers until it reaches 12% moisture.

About the producer

Gloria Cecilia Sepulveda

A mentee of Carmen Montoya, Gloria refines her coffee processing skills, striving to share her meticulous craftsmanship with the world.

About the farm

El Porvenir

Gloria shares a piece of land with her cousin and mentor, Carmen. It’s the ideal setting for her to make a living from coffee while dedicating herself to meticulous processing to achieve a clean, distinctive cup.

Altitude

2000 m

Size of the farm

1 Hectares & 1 employee

Varieties

Caturra, Chiroso

Harvest Season

October - March
